About Parish Church of St Mary the Virgin
The Parish Church of St Mary the Virgin serves Pilton, a suburb of Barnstaple in Devon. This active Church of England parish church belongs to the Diocese of Exeter and has held Grade I listed status since 1951.
Its origins lie in Pilton Priory, a Benedictine house established between 925 and 940 under Malmesbury Abbey. The present church combines work from the 13th and 15th centuries, with its dedication recorded in 1259. Local slatestone in purple, grey and brown tones is complemented by sandstone details and slate roofing. After Civil War damage, Robert Nutting rebuilt the tower in 1696, while further work followed between 1845 and 1850. Surviving features include traces of medieval stained glass, a stone pulpit dating from about 1550, an Elizabethan communion rail and an eight-bell peal, some bells dating to 1712. Notable memorials commemorate members of the Chichester family.
